prevention of sports injuries, as the sole prevalent adverse effect of physical activity, could potentially benefit a wide spectrum of individuals involved in any form of exercise.3–6 While the management of sports injuries can be troublesome, time-consuming and expensive, prevention in the form of strength training has proved to be accessible, effective and cost-effective for populations.7

Sports Injury Prevention Tips from the American Academy of Pediatrics 3/16/2017 Injury Risks All sports have a risk of injury. Fortunately, for the vast majority of youth, the benefits of sports participation outweigh the risks. In general, the more contact in a sport, the greater the risk of a traumatic injury. Abstract. In 1992 van Mechelen et al published a “sequence of prevention model” based on a four-step process. This model has been widely used to implement preventive measures in response to sports injuries.
The sports environment includes not only the weather, but also the facilities, surfaces and equipment that are being used. Poor, wet or slippery surfaces, lack of goalpost padding or safety netting, obstacles to trip on and sharp objects, can all lead to injury.

Assessing the best prevention strategies fora sports or recreational injury requires a full understanding of the factors that contribute to both the occurrence of these injuries and the uptake of, or compliance with, potential prevention strategies.

A common rotator cuff injury that occurs among athletes is known as swimmer’s shoulder. Swimmer’s shoulder is an athletic overuse . injury that occurs when the rotator cuff becomes inflamed.
